    🎯 Key Takeaways for quick navigation:
    00:00 📸 AI Image Generators Overview
    - Introduction to various AI image generators and the need to choose the best one for specific use cases.
    01:08 🔍 Accuracy Assessment
    - Testing accuracy by providing prompts and evaluating how well each AI image generator adheres to them.
    04:09 🎨 Creativity Evaluation
    - Assessing the creativity of AI image generators by giving them minimal context and examining the resulting images.
    08:37 🌟 Realism Analysis
    - Analyzing the realism of AI-generated images using a specific prompt and evaluating how convincingly they depict the scenario.
    18:50 🎨 AI Image Realism Test
    - Mid Journey raw, Firefly 2, and Mid Journey without raw scored the highest in realism.
    - Google and idiogram performed poorly in creating realistic images.
    19:59 🖌️ AI Image Illustrations Test
    - Mid Journey in nii mode excelled in creating colorful and contrasty illustrations.
    - Style raw mode wasn't suitable for illustrations.
    - Dolly 3, Bing Image Creator, Leonardo, and Firefly 2 produced decent illustrations, but lacked the contrast of Mid Journey.
    26:13 🏞️ AI Image Tiling Test
    - Mid Journey, both regular and raw, successfully created tileable images.
    - Dolly 3, Bing Image Creator, Leonardo, Firefly 2, Google, and idiogram struggled to create seamless tileable images.
    29:42 📝 AI Text in Image Test
    - Mid Journey and Mid Journey raw failed to generate accurate text in images.
    - Dolly 3 produced some images with text, but with typos.
    - Bing Image Creator also generated text, but with typos.
    - Leonardo and Firefly 2 didn't perform well in generating text.
    - Google and idiogram successfully added text to images, but Google struggled with multiple words.
    33:53 🚫 AI Censorship Test
    - Mid Journey and Mid Journey raw had minimal censorship, allowing celebrity and IP-related content.
    - Dolly 3 restricted some content based on policies.
    - Bing Image Creator had increased censorship, blocking certain prompts.
    - Leonardo showed no censorship and allowed various content.
    - Firefly 2 had significant censorship, blocking both Tom Hanks and SpongeBob with Super Mario.
    - Google had censorship issues, blocking Tom Hanks and Super Mario-related prompts.
    - Idiogram had some censorship but allowed certain content.
    37:07 🖼️ Image Generation and Censorship
    - Dolly, Firefly, and Leonardo can generate various images effectively.
    - Idiogram appears uncensored but lacks in image quality.
    - Mid Journey and Google have usability and censorship issues.
    38:32 🤖 Usability Evaluation
    - Mid Journey's Discord interface can be overwhelming.
    - Dolly 3 in Chat GPT offers a familiar chat interface.
    - Leonardo provides versatility with a user-friendly interface.
    42:17 💰 Pricing Comparison
    - Mid Journey offers a $10 monthly plan with limitations.
    - Dolly 3 in Chat GPT is the most expensive at $20 per month.
    - Leonardo has a free plan and a $10 per month plan, providing good value.
    - Firefly offers a free plan and a paid plan at $5 per month.
    - Google's image generator is free to use.
    - Idiogram is currently entirely free.
    45:45 🏆 Conclusion and Recommendations
    - Leonardo is recommended as the best value with a score of 75.5.
    - Mid Journey and Idiogram offer different strengths and drawbacks.
    - Dolly 3 in Chat GPT is less recommended due to high cost and censorship.
    - Dolly 3 in Bing's Image Creator is an accurate, free alternative.

    With DALL-E (2024/2) it is important to start a new chat any time you begin a new image concept, otherwise the context window will come to bear on the image produced.
    Also, DALL-E is using an LLM expert to take the raw prompt into the actual prompt that is sent to the model for inference/diffusion. If you call the Open A.I. API via a script, the JSON response includes the actual prompt sent for inference. See hugging face spaces for various "prompt generators" which provide similar functionality for the various A.I. systems including midjourney & stable diffusion.

      If you look at the actual prompt that GPT uses, it changes words, puts in synonyms and uses flowery language like "captivating the feeling of loneliness" which I think at best is wasted on DALL-E 3 as it knows shapes, color and textures, not emotions. You can tell GPT how it should prompt or even insist that it takes your prompt exactly word for word. I highly recommend Glibatree's RUclips video on custom instructions for DALL-E 3 and you'll get much better images in no time
